The Michigan Junior Hoopers Fundamental program is entering its 8th season and is the fastest growing basketball program for ages 4-9 in Metro Detroit. Players will experience success, as each drill/instruction will be adapted to a players appropriate skill level. Program Overview:
Learn the importance of listening |Work on improving body control | Learn what the triple threat position is and when/why to use it | Gain strength and confidence in ball handling | Learn and practice proper shooting mechanics | Learn different types of passes & when to execute | Team concepts

  DIrector: Rob Crandall Jr. is in his 5th season as Jr. Hoopers director and is the owner of FLASH Training. Coach Crandall graduated from Grand Valley State University in 2005 with a B.S. in Movement Science.

Crandall has been a part of many collegiate and high school programs within the past 7 years. Also, he has spent time working with young players in the middle schools and through AAU programs. Crandall looks forward to improving players’ games and lives. His final goal is to make a difference and be a positive role model.
